The Mona Lisa: Louvre's Iconic Masterpiece

Leonardo da Vinci's Mona Lisa is arguably the most famous painting in the world. Created in the early 16th century, it is renowned for its enigmatic smile and exquisite detail.

Housed in the Denon Wing of the Louvre, the painting draws thousands of visitors every day. Its fame is not only due to Leonardo’s mastery but also the mysteries surrounding the subject’s identity and expression.

Visitor Tips

  • Be prepared for crowds; the painting is displayed behind bulletproof glass.
  • Approach from the right side for the best viewing angle.
  • Learn about the painting’s history and details via audio guides or a guided tour.
  • Visit early in the day for a quieter experience.
